lora
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édenteDernière révisionLes deux révisions suivantes | ||
lora [2019/01/24 12:56] – bigMax | lora [2019/11/10 21:10] – Benjamin Labomedia |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
====== LoRa : un protocole de communication radio longue distance & low energy ====== | ====== LoRa : un protocole de communication radio longue distance & low energy ====== | ||
+ | <WRAP center round important 60%> | ||
+ | Attention, il faut distinguer [[ LoRa ]] et [[ LoRaWAN ]]. [[ LoRa ]] est un protocole propriétaire de communication radio. [[ LoRaWAN ]] est un protocole de communication réseau couplé à une infrastructure de passerelles (gateways) qui permet à de court messages émis par Radio d' | ||
+ | </ | ||
<WRAP center round info 60%> | <WRAP center round info 60%> | ||
- | La page wikipedia FR est plutot | + | La page wikipedia FR est plutôt |
</ | </ | ||
- | Achat de 2 transceiver (émetteur/ | + | * Achat de 2 transceiver (émetteur/ |
+ | * Achat d'une “Chistera-Pi” basé sur le [[rfm95]] compatible LoRaWAN. | ||
===== Antennes ===== | ===== Antennes ===== | ||
+ | * [[antenne_radio ]] | ||
* [[ https:// | * [[ https:// | ||
* [[ https:// | * [[ https:// | ||
Ligne 12: | Ligne 16: | ||
* [[ https:// | * [[ https:// | ||
- | ===== Ressources | + | ===== Build a gateway for the Thingnetwork |
- | La documentation fournit par the TTN est interessante : [[ https:// | + | * From zero to LoRaWAN |
- | Guides pour construire une gateway LoRaWAN : | + | ===== Legislation 868 MHz ===== |
- | * [[ https:// | + | cf [[ https:// |
- | * [[ https:// | + | |
- | * [[ https:// | + | |
- | * [[ https:// | + | |
- | + | ||
- | Liste des gateway LoRaWAN existantes : [[ https:// | + | |
+ | ===== Ressources ===== | ||
Un calculateur de link budget : [[ https:// | Un calculateur de link budget : [[ https:// | ||
Ligne 28: | Ligne 28: | ||
DIY LoRa antenne : [[ https:// | DIY LoRa antenne : [[ https:// | ||
- | |||
- | Code Arduino pour une Single channel LoRaWAN Gateway basé sur un ESP32 : https:// | ||
===== Technologie ===== | ===== Technologie ===== | ||
- | * LoRaWAN ADR (Adaptive Data Rate) : [[ https:// | ||
* RSSI (Radio Signal Strength Indicator) certains device mesure le RSSI | * RSSI (Radio Signal Strength Indicator) certains device mesure le RSSI | ||
* SNR calculé à partir du RSSI ? | * SNR calculé à partir du RSSI ? | ||
- | ===== Materiel ===== | ||
- | Pour commencer à jouer, on peut utiliser les 2 transceivers sx1276 tel le [[ e45-ttl-100]]. Néanmoins, pour des raisons de simplicités, | ||
- | * Le ic880a : [[ https:// | ||
- | * Le RAK831 : il vaut environ 140€ en chine, c'est un peu plus chèr que le ic880a, il faudrait les comparer. | ||
- | |||
- | <WRAP center round tip 60%> | ||
- | Un super guide de TTN suisse pour construire une gateway LoRaWAN : [[ https:// | ||
- | </ | ||
- | |||
- | |||
- | ===== Synoptique de publication de données d'un émetteur LoRa sur Internet avec TTN ===== | ||
- | Dans l' | ||
- | dédié d'un broker MQTT de TTN. | ||
- | |||
- | ==== TTN workflow ==== | ||
- | * Il faut créer une application sur TTN | ||
- | * Il faut attacher son device à son application | ||
- | * Lorsque la TTN gateway reçoit un message LoRa elle le transmet à TTN, qui le route vers une application en fonction de l' | ||
- | * TTN pousse alors par defaut le message au format json dans une file MQTT. | ||
===== Glossaire ===== | ===== Glossaire ===== | ||
Ligne 79: | Ligne 57: | ||
* RAK811 node: [[ https:// | * RAK811 node: [[ https:// | ||
- | ===== Authentification / Sécurité ===== | ||
- | * [[ https:// | ||
- | |||
- | Each LoRaWAN device is personalized with a unique 128 bit AES key (called AppKey) and a globally unique identifier (EUI-64-based DevEUI), both of which are used during the device authentication process. Allocation of EUI-64 identifiers require the assignor to have an Organizationally Unique Identifier (OUI) from the IEEE Registration Authority. Similarly, LoRaWAN networks are identified by a 24-bit globally unique identifier assigned by the LoRa Alliance™. | ||
- | * [[ https:// | ||
- | * [[ https:// | ||
- | {{tag> | + | {{tag> |
lora.txt · Dernière modification : 2020/07/25 09:14 de bigMax